2-Year-Old Dies After Falling Into Open Drain in North Delhi; Safety Lapses Raise Concern

Date:

New Delhi, May 4: A tragic incident in North Delhi’s Bhalswa Dairy area has once again raised serious concerns over public safety and open drainage hazards, after a two-year-old girl died after falling into an uncovered drain near her home.

According to police, information was received regarding the child missing from Mukundpur Part-II. Acting swiftly, a search operation was launched with the help of family members. During the search, the girl was found in a drain located about 15 metres from her residence. She was immediately taken to BJRM Hospital, where doctors declared her brought dead.

The body has been preserved at the hospital mortuary for post-mortem examination. Police said that no foul play is suspected at this stage, and preliminary findings suggest the child may have accidentally fallen into the open drain while playing outside her house.

The incident highlights ongoing concerns about uncovered drains and lack of safety measures in residential areas, which continue to pose a threat, especially to children.

Further inquiry is underway, and police said appropriate action will be taken based on the findings of the post-mortem report and any complaint received from the family.
